Samtec provides a recommended PCB layout and land pattern in their Application Notes document, which can be found on their website. It's essential to follow these guidelines to ensure proper mating and to prevent damage to the connector or PCB.
While the CLT-112-02-F-D-A-P is a rugged connector, it's still important to consider the specific environmental requirements of your application. Samtec recommends consulting their Environmental Performance document, which provides guidance on vibration, shock, and other environmental factors.
The CLT-112-02-F-D-A-P has an operating temperature range of -55°C to +125°C, but it's essential to note that the temperature rating may vary depending on the specific application and environment. Consult the datasheet and Samtec's Temperature Rating document for more information.
The CLT-112-02-F-D-A-P is designed for high-speed signal applications, with a bandwidth of up to 10 Gbps. However, it's crucial to consider the specific signal integrity requirements of your application and to consult Samtec's Signal Integrity document for more information.
